The Shelby County Treasurer and Tax Collector's Office collects property taxes for a county or local government and maintains a number of property-related records. These can include Shelby County property tax assessment reports, property appraisals, property tax bills, and tax bill due dates, as well as parcel numbers, property descriptions, and property owner information. The Treasurer and Tax Collector also keeps records on paid and unpaid property taxes, tax liens, and foreclosures, and they provide property tax bill services, including setting up property tax payment plans, appealing a property tax assessment, and applying for a property tax refund in Shelby County, Illinois. Searching for Shelby County property tax bill information can help current owners and prospective buyers, and property tax bill records are available on the Treasurer and Tax Collector website.
Shelby County Treasurer's Office Shelbyville IL 301 East Main Street 62565 217-774-3841
